They do shakes, soups porridge and choc bars, there are a lot of different options available to u with or without food involved! shakes and stuff range from about 1.70-2.00 each so depending on the plan u go on it will be maximum of around 42 but that would be with no food or very little

If you're going for a meal replacement diet have you looked at slimfast or tescos own? I've looked into it and I really can't see much difference apart from the price and the fact you don't go and see someone else to get weighed. I'm not on it fully but i do use the tesco shakes for when i've not had a chance to eat (like breakfast when we are rushing to go out) and they are yummy :) £2 for 3x 330ml shakes :) Their recommended way if you are on it fully is 1 shake or snack for breakfast and lunch and then a healthy meal for tea with snacks of fruit etc in between :)
 
Slimfast and the likes are just full of sugar. They aren't actual meal replacements. They have very little protein and vits/minerals.
 
Ive been on this diet before i used to pay £37 a week this was o supply me with 3 shakes/soups per day for a week as this is what most CD councillers recommend to do it without the food...its basically 3/4 shakes or soups a day and drinking plenty of water.

Or you could do the next option which is pretty much the same but your allowed abit of chicken n veg a day to along with the 3 shakes/soups .

There are other options of your daily intake but for faster weight loss they recommend what ive just said above.

It is a hard diet but most people get used to it after a week or so i go slimming world now and i wouldnt look back on going on this diet again.
 
No one from CD could advise me how different they were when I asked. Yes they have more sugar but just 2 shakes will provide you with 32% (only copper is this low) and 98% RDA of vitamins and minerals and seeing as you are supposed to eat 2/3 heathy snacks aswell and a full meal, I can't see reaching RDAs a problem :) When I can get 3 shakes for the price of 1 CD i'm happy to "deal" with any increased sugar content :)
